如何使用NativeScript自动完成

时间:2018-12-20 12:14:15

标签: javascript nativescript

我需要对autocompleteNativescript,但是我在互联网上找不到任何东西,我需要的是在键入时将键入的文本发送到API ,我发现的只是现有数组。 有没有人经历过某些事情并提出解决方案?

2 个答案:

答案 0 :(得分:2)

安装

npm install nativescript-autocomplete

用法

重要提示:请确保在页面元素上包括xmlns:ac="nativescript-autocomplete"

例如

item:Array<string> = ['1','2','3','4']
itemTapped(args){
    const eventName = args.eventName;
    const data = args.data;
    const view = args.view;
    const index = args.index;
    const object = args.object;
}
<ac:Autocomplete  items="{{list}}" itemTap="itemTapped"/>

来源:https://github.com/triniwiz/nativescript-autocomplete 如果遇到问题,请参见此:https://github.com/triniwiz/nativescript-autocomplete/issues/8

答案 1 :(得分:0)

结帐RadAutoCompleteTextView

安装

tns plugin add nativescript-ui-autocomplete

也支持Angular&Vue。

由于您提到您将拥有一个将返回值的api,因此您必须使用Async Data

更多示例可以在Github repo中找到。